7.5.1.1 Quality management system documentation
The organization’s quality management system shall be documented and include a quality manual,
which can be a series of documents (electronic or hard copy).
The format and structure of the quality manual is at the discretion of the organization and will
depend on the organization's size, culture, and complexity- If a series of documents is used, then a
list shall be retained of the documents that comprise the quality manual for the organization.
The quality manual shall include, at a minimum, the following:

a) the scope of the quality management system, including details of and justification for any
exclusions;
b) documented processes established for the quality management system, or reference to them;
c) the organization's processes and their sequence and interactions (inputs and outputs], including
type and extent of control of any outsourced processes;
d) a document (i.e., matrix for example, a table, a list, or a matrix) indicating where within the organization’s quality management system their customer-specific requirements are addressed.

NOTE a matrix of how the requirements of this Automotive QMS standard are addressed by the organization's processes may be used to assist with linkages of the organization's processes and this Automotive QMS.
